Junbpaw 3080W Pure Sine Wave Power Inverter
The Junbpaw 3080W Pure Sine Wave Power Inverter is a high-capacity power converter designed to deliver stable and clean AC power from DC sources like batteries. With a continuous output of 3080 watts, this pure sine wave inverter is suitable for powering sensitive electronics, household appliances, tools, and off-grid systems where reliable power is essential.
Pure sine wave inverters produce clean electrical output that closely resembles grid power, which is critical for devices such as microwaves, computers, TVs, medical equipment, and more.

Performance & Power Delivery
With 3080 watts of continuous power, this inverter can run a variety of large and small loads. Typical use cases include:
Powering refrigerators, freezers, and large appliances
Running computers, TVs, and entertainment systems
Supporting power tools (drills, saws, compressors)
Emergency backup power at home
Solar off-grid installations with battery banks
Pure sine wave output is especially important because it delivers stable and clean AC power, avoiding the electrical noise and inefficiency associated with modified sine wave inverters. This makes it safe for sensitive electronics and devices that require precise power input.
Installation & Setup
Proper installation is crucial for performance and safety. General setup steps include:
Choose a stable and ventilated location — free from moisture and obstruction
Connect DC input to a compatible battery or DC power source
Ground the inverter for safety
Connect AC output to the load or electrical distribution panel
Verify polarity and secure connections before powering on
For high power inverters like this, professional installation by an electrician or experienced technician is recommended — especially when integrating with home or solar systems.
